The potential of the cell under standard conditions (1 m for solutions, 1 atm for gases, pure solids or liquids for other substances) and at a fixed temperature (25 c) is called the standard cell potential (e cell). The standard cell potential (\(e^o_{cell}\)) is the difference of the two electrodes, which forms the voltage of that cell. Cell potential is a macroscopic property that considers the overall behavior of an electrochemical cell, taking into account the redox reactions.
